Quick question, what's the best blank tshirt for small businesses? I've seen people recommend bella+canvas & gildan softstyle.
Hey Janine! I think that any brand will work, to be honest, and sometimes your customers may request a certain style or brand. Brands like Bella Canvas will have a higher price point, so then your prices will need to reflect that, where a cheaper shirt like Gildan Softstyle can have a lower price point, but may not be as soft. I do like the Gildan Softstyle a lot, but it is personal preference. I would start with shirts that you personally like, then go from there. Hope this helps! ---Becky
